Ethopropazine Hydrochloride

  • Ethopropazine Hydrochloride manages Parkinson’s disease symptoms by reducing tremors and rigidity.
  • Ethopropazine Hydrochloride is an anticholinergic agent with central nervous system activity.

Chemical Formula:

  • C₁₉H₂₄N₂S·HCl

 Chemical Structure of Ethopropazine Hydrochloride

Mechanism of Action:

  • Anticholinergic + mild antihistaminic
  • Used as a CNS agent for movement disorders

Therapeutic Uses of Ethopropazine Hydrochloride:

  • Parkinsonism
  • Drug-induced tremors or rigidity

Side Effects of Ethopropazine Hydrochloride:

  • Sedation
  • Dry mouth
  • Confusion (especially in elderly)
